What do I need to put into my configuration file(s)?

I'm running net-snmp 5.4.1. I want to register an OID for a subagent 
with a particular context (because I need to register the same OID 
for other subagents with other contexts). It works for snmpv1, but of 
course my application requires it to work for snmpv3.

After trying everything -- I am very new to SNMP -- I finally got the 
Master Agent to forward the request to the subagent when I copied the 
createUser line from snmpd.conf to subagent1.conf. It works, but with 
a blank context.

I set the context in my subagent by using this code (which came from 
a Solaris demo_module_6):

         myreg = netsnmp_create_handler_registration(
                         "elementName",
                         get_elementCallback,
                         element_oid,
                         OID_LENGTH(element_oid),
                         HANDLER_CAN_RONLY);

         myreg->contextName = "myContext";

         netsnmp_register_read_only_instance(myreg);

but the subagent message to the Master Agent does not include the 
context string, so of course the Master Agent is unable to recognize 
that a GET should be forwarded to my subagent. Instead it decides 
VACM_NOSUCHCONTEXT. What do I need to configure to make this happen? 
The following command, as I said, works with v1 or with no context:

snmpget -r 1 -mALL -v 3 -u myuser -n "context" -l authNoPriv -A 
"my_password" localhost .elementName
